DBSoft.dll是大兵系列软件的必备插件,功能十分强大,包括文字识别、加解密类别、计算、mdb数据库、声音类别、硬件类别、字符串类别、注册表等,为您进行程序开发带来了极大的便利,有需要的朋友可以来本站下载!
DBSoft.dll功能
1、硬件类别:主要能获取硬盘,U盘,网卡,CPU的各项参数等
2、字符串类别:主要对字符串进行筛选,判断,生成,格式化等
3、文字识别:对正规文字及非正规文字的识别等
4、鼠标键盘:模拟鼠标键盘,判断鼠标形状,判断键盘状态,发送鼠标键盘信息等
5、图片类别:前后台抓图,找图,图片处理,格式转换等
6、时间日期:获取网络时间,对时间日期计算、设置等
7、系统类别:获取系统各项参数,执行系统部分功能,关机,取得和设置屏幕分别率,色深等
8、加解密类别:针对文件和字符串加解密等
9、网络:获取IP,上传下载,ping等
10、颜色类别:获取屏幕,软件及图片的颜色等
11、控件类别:对WINDOWS窗口的listbox,combobox,文本框等操作等
12、各种计算:各种三角计算,进制转换,方位角计算,最短路径计算等
13、文件目录:主要对系统文件目录的各种创建,删除,移动,搜索以及文件属性获取设置等操作等
14、文本文件:主要对文本文件的读写,搜索,替换等操作等
15、注册表:主要对注册表的创建,删除,读写等操作等
16、INI类别:主要对ini文件的读写,搜索,替换等操作等
17、EXCEl:主要对Excel文件的读写,搜索,替换等操作等
18、MDB数据库:主要对MDB数据库的读写,搜索,替换等操作等
19、内存类别:对剪切板,内存进行读写操作等
20、弹出窗口类别:弹出各种信息窗口等
21、声音类别:播放各种声音等
22、IE相关:设置IE,IE填写点击等操作,获取网页源代码,网址提交等
23、窗口类别:主要对WINDOWS窗口搜索句柄,操作窗口,菜单点击等。
DBSoft.dll参数说明
1、窗口句柄或者图片路径
如果为窗口句柄,句柄要求为数字≥0,0表示当前屏幕,采用屏幕坐标系统,其余采用窗口坐标系统(窗口方式为后台方式)
如果为图片,要求为字符串,支持相对路径
2、识别范围左上角X(数字≥0),识别不出来,可适当减小
3、识别范围左上角Y(数字≥0),要求准确
4、识别范围右下角X(数字≥0),建议比实际文字范围大1像素
5、识别范围右下角Y(数字≥0),建议比实际文字范围大1像素
6、识别字体类型(数字0、1、2),可选参数,默认为2
0表示未加粗字体,字库默认情况下名字后面有"_N"
1表示粗体字体,字库默认情况下名字后面有"_B"
2表示用粗体字库识别未加粗字体(不是所有字库都支持),字库默认情况下名字后面有"_B"
7、识别类型(数字0~3),可选参数,默认为0
0表示识别汉字混排,没没识别出来的地方忽略
1表示识别单纯数字,没没识别出来的地方忽略
2表示识别汉字混排,没识别出来的用空格代替(全角字符和汉字用双空格,半角字符、数字用单空格)
3表示识别单纯数字,没识别出来的用空格代替(全角字符和汉字用双空格,半角字符、数字用单空格)
8、字库路径及密码(字符串,文件名和扩展名,例如"Songti_11_B.Dll"、"Songti_11_B.ini"或者"Songti_11_B.Pzk"),支持相对路径,可选参数,默认为"Songti_11_B.Dll"。扩展名可省略,如果省略扩展名,则搜索扩展名为dll、ini、Pzk文件,寻找顺序为dll,ini,Pzk(识别速度由快到慢)。如果字库加密,请在字库文件路径写上密码并用分号隔开(没有请勿填写),例如"Songti_11_B.Pzk;123456",或者"c:\Songti_11_B.Pzk;123456"
9、文字横向净距(文字间隔)(数字≥0),可选参数,默认为1
10、文字纵向净距(文字间隔)(数字≥0),可选参数,默认为1
11、识别颜色(字符串,如"000000",16进制颜色代码),可选参数,默认为"000000",此参数可带入多个颜色值,例如"00FFFF,FFFFFF,00FF00",可同时识别多种颜色文字
12、颜色情况(数字0、1),可选参数,默认为0(数字0~1,0表示文字颜色,1表示背景色)
13、颜色偏差,可选参数,默认为0,此参数可以使用数字和字符串,例如0,"0","0,0,0"将代表同一个意思。
使用字符串,例如"10,20,30"来分别设置RGB偏差(只能设置3个偏差,顺序为R、G、B),那么RGB偏差分别为R=10,G=20,B=30,如果只输入一个,那么将默认为RGB偏差都为此数,例如"10",RGB偏差分别为R=10,G=10,B=10,如果大于1个,那么将分别设置RGB偏差,缺少的将默认为0,例如"10,10",RGB偏差分别为R=10,G=10,B=0,大于三个将取前三个。
RGB偏差有效范围为0-255,大于255等同255,小于0等同0,数字越大,识别匹配越广(建议不要设置超过254)
14、设定识别字符串(字符串),可选参数,默认为空字符串""。设定字符后(例如“大并插件”)将返回包含"大兵插件"的第一个文字"大"的左上角X、Y坐标,返回一维数组,依次表示x,y,失败返回-1,-1
15、误差识别率(数字0.5~1.0,1.0表示完全一样,数字越小差别越大),可选参数,默认为1.0。能识别有干扰的正规文字,支持字库为ini和Pzk格式,如果进行抗干扰模糊识别,建议将字库尽可能的减小,最好只保留必要的数据,数据库越大,识别速度越慢
16、换行分隔符(字符串),可选参数,默认为空""。设定不为空后,将对多行识别时每行文字之间隔断字符(字符串),常用的有",",";"和换行VbCrLf,例如文本有五行,分别为12、23、64、36和78,默认识别结果为"1223643678",如果此参数设置为",",结果为"12,23,64,36,78",如果参数14为"36",因默认识别结果"1223643678"里面有两个36,结果会导致想返回坐标的时候返回第一个,如果想避免这种情况,这时请设置分隔符。
更新日志
1、修复写EXCEL文件WriteOpenExcel,第6个参数设置不保存失败bug
2、优化判断是否连接到Internet函数CheckNET,增加判断准确性
3、升级语音朗读函数VoiceSpeek,增加支持自定义语音引擎关键字的功能
4、修正函数GetFrameDom中的一个bug
5、修正函数GetSystemFolder出错的bug
6、修正部分网卡获取函数获取失败的bug
7、修复修改网卡地址函数ChangeMAC可能会修改失败的bug
8、增加函数启动或关闭网卡ChangeMACStatus